SP56 OBA is a 2006 Kia Sportage in Black with a 1,991c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.
Across all 2006 Kia Sportage models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.4% with a typical mileage of 78,394 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Kia Sportage f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 16,003 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SP56 OBA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Sportage typ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 20 years old, this Kia Sportage is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
